Conceptual
The latest prevalent trust you to definitely people look alike has experienced specific empirical support. Right here i take a look at specific perceptual attributes out of confronts that will membership because of it resemblance. Round the a couple of training judges ranked sensed years, elegance, and you can five characteristics of hitched individuals’ faces. Correlations indicated that imagined ages, elegance and several character traits was equivalent between partners and this coordinating getting understood identity happened although managing to have years and you can appeal of the fresh faces. So it wanting could possibly get mirror anyone going for people which truly end up like themselves or people just who seem to have equivalent characters in order to themselves. Data also showed that partners that had been together offered appeared alot more comparable during the sensed characteristics, that could echo lovers increasing a whole lot more similar inside noticeable personality more big date or that people lookin similar when you look at the character stay together with her lengthened.
Introduction
It’s a widespread faith one to couples look alike. Mating with similar people at the profile over opportunity is known as self-confident assortative mating (e.grams., Thiessen & Gregg, 1980) plus in of many creature types is one of widely reported mating trend (Burley, 1983).
Early research toward peoples assortative mating concerned about correlations on measurements of anthropometric properties anywhere between people such as for example sleeve duration and you will handbreadth. Such as for instance, Spuhler (1968) grabbed 43 bodily specifications from 205 married people and found significant confident correlations on the 30 of these measurements also seven out-of fifteen face or cranial specifications. Zero negative correlations were said. Product reviews regarding early knowledge for the spouse similarity, off research comprising nearly seventy decades, show an overall total trend regarding reasonable confident correlations (0.01–0.35) for the majority of actual enjoys (Roberts, 1977, Spuhler, 1968). Newer degree dealing with circumstances for example age (Malina, Selby, Buschang, Aronson, & Nothing, 1983) and cohabitation (Allison mais aussi al., 1996) including demonstrated positive correlations without a doubt features and you will together with her these studies show that self-confident assortative mating having actual attributes takes place into the people marriage ceremonies (although see Lykken & Tellegen, 1993).
About three research has tested whether married people enjoys similar facial functions. Griffiths and you may Kunz (1973) grabbed photographs from maried people and you can expected professionals to fit right up the fresh images away from real people off a small group of confronts. Couples married for less than ten years as well as more 20 ages have been matched at levels a lot more than possibility however, victims did not match partners hitched having between 10 and you may 2 decades.
Zajonc, Adelmann, Murphy, and you will Niendenthal (1987) performed a comparable check out, hypothesising that people do not couples due to resemblance, but be much more actually equivalent throughout the years on account of sharing similar diets, life-style and you can emotional event. To possess a dozen maried people, people were given you to definitely pictures on the first 12 months plus one pictures on 25th season of one’s relationship. Even in the event judges were not able to match couples much better than chance inside the first season off matrimony, images about 25th season out of relationship was rated as more equivalent than just is requested by chance.
Hinsz (1989) along with studied facial resemblance in the real couples playing with photographs out of interested partners and you can couples hitched for around twenty five years. Users was indeed given opposite-gender pairs out of images, and you may questioned to help you speed the resemblance between the two confronts. 50 % of this new pairs displayed were genuine partners, and you may half of were randomly generated lovers. Actual partners was basically rated as the even more similar than just at random generated people. Rather than Zajonc mais aussi al. (1987), partners that were along with her for extended amounts of time was in fact not regarded as way more similar than the new lovers. Hence knowledge out-of face resemblance mean that couples is detected so you can be much more facially exactly like both than asked by accident, though the matchmaking between union size and you will face similarity was unclear.
